Hello everyone,
Does anyone know of any GOOD coffee or expresso places with lots of selections at WDW? I am a big fan of coffee and I want to check some out on my next visit. I'm hoping to find a good fresh choice, not just a typical daily brew.

I agree. If you want your coffee in the morning when the park just opens go to the Writer's shop not Starring Rolls, it 110% less crowd. When we went during the summer and Star War weekends there was a huge line at Starring Roll but only one person in the Writer's Shop, and in my opinion it has good coffee.
